Selling Sunset
A brand new Selling Sunset season arrived on Netflix on November 3.
All 11 episodes were dropped and available to stream at once. Although fans had to wait for the show’s juicy reunion to arrive on November 15.
Tan France hosts the hit show’s get-together as the cast airs all its disputes and drama from season 7.
90 Day Fiancé
Anyone who’s heard of reality TV must’ve heard of 90 Day Fiancé.
The absolutely iconic dating show sees people travel across the world in order to put their relationships to the test. Will they last the 90 days and end up happily married? Or, will chaos erupt and everything end in tears?
This year’s season (10) sees the return of Gino Palazzolo and Jasmine Pineda, as well as six new couples who are facing the hurdles of living together after globetrotting for love.
The Kardashians
As if Kar-Jenner fans thought that the world’s most famous reality TV family was about to bow out of the game after 20 seasons of Keeping Up With the Kardashians.
Momager Kris Jenner, Kim Kardashian, Kylie Jenner, and co all returned for their brand new show, The Kardashians, in 2022.
Airing on Hulu each week, The Kardashians is now in its fourth season, and episode 8 released on November 16.
Married to Medicine
Married To Medicine is back this year with its 10th season. Now, mortician Phaedra Parkes is breathing new life into the show.
The Bravo show follows the much-loved cast which includes doctors – or ladies in relationships with medical professionals.
Dr Jackie Walters, Dr Heavenly Kimes, Quadd Webb, and the rest of the ladies are all living and working in Atlanta, Georgia.
Southern Charm
Southern Charm season 9 kicked off on September 14 and, as always, wherever the cast goes, drama seems to follow.
Shep Rose, Taylor Ann Green, and Madison LeCroy welcome some newbies to the cast this year.
While Venita Aspen takes Fashion Week by storm, Madison is mulling over expanding her family and Craig Conover and Paige DeSorbo talk kids and marriage.
Bachelor In Paradise
Warming up the cold winter months, Bachelor In Paradise is here bringing some spicy love triangles to screens this year.
Season 9 of the hit ABC show kicked off on September 28. The all-new series sees familiar faces from The Bachelor and The Bachelorette attempt to find love on the sands of Mexico.
Kylee Russell had an idea of who she wanted to leave the show before he even arrived, and some couples are rocked by new arrivals and exes showing up on the beach.
The Real Housewives of Potomac
Robyn Dixon, Ashley Darby, Gizelle Bryant, and the rest of the Real Housewives of Potomac ladies return for a brand new season on November 5.
Season 8 brings newbie Nneka Ihim to the Bravo show which is brimming with drama this year. From infidelity rumors to new love interests, interventions, and much more, reality lovers will have a field day with RHOP.
